Tippmann 98 Custom Platinum Power Pack


1. Description

Tippmann’s new 98 Custom® Platinum Series Power Pack is now easier to upgrade, modify and maintain. The Power Pack also includes a 9-ounce CO2 tank (CO2 not included) and a high-performance goggle with anti-fog lens.

New Features Include:

* Split Receiver Design, which provides easier access to internal components for simplified installation of grip upgrades and modifications
* Secure Front Sight Spring and Trigger Pins, which makes the marker easier to service and reassemble
* Easy-to-Remove Power Tube Design with self-sealing/locking gas line secures the valve in place and eliminates two bolts from previous design making maintaining the marker quicker and easier
* Full Depth Pockets for ASA, which eliminates the need to loosen the ASA bolts when disassembling the marker
* New Barrel Porting and a Matte Finish, which improves marker air efficiency and reduces reflective glare
* Picatinny Rails, which makes adding a carry handle, scopes and other accessories a snap
* Redesigned, Vertical Front Grip, which offers improved stability and added texture for a more secure feel
* Redesigned Sling Mount End Cap, which allows players to easily attach a variety of different sling styles

There is also a new Quick Thread Flatline® Barrel, which attaches as easily as any other barrel to save players significant time and effort. The new Platinum Series maintains the core features of the original 98 Custom including ACT (Anti Chop Technology), all aluminum die cast receiver, quick-release feeder elbow and a 200-round hopper. It’s fully compatible for CO2, compressed air, or nitrogen.

2. Specification

Caliber: 0.68

Action: Semi-automatic
Power: CO2, compressed air, nitrogen

Hopper Capacity: 200
CO2 Capacity: 9 oz. cylinder

Feed rate: 8 BPS
Firing rate: 8 BPS

Trigger: Standard
Barrel length: 8.5 inches

Length: 19.6 inches
Weight: 2.9 lbs (without tank)

Effective Range: 150+ ft

Where to Play Paintball

Paintball is usually played in neighborhood backyards, somewhere in the woods, or on abandoned or empty lots. Though it is usually alright to hold paintball games at these places, there are safer venues for having paintball competitions.

Many fields specially designed for paintball games are being developed in the U.S. These organized fields allow paintball players to have their games in a safe environment.

It is recommended that paintball games be held in commercial fields rather than backyards and empty lots. Commercial fields have referees who know how to play the game in a safe manner. In addition, commercial fields offer several
choices when it comes to types of field, making the games more interesting and challenging for the players. Most importantly, these fields have insurance, and are in the proper zone.

If one decides to play in the woods, make sure permission is granted to play there. No one wants to have a game interrupted by an angry landowner because his or her property is being trespassed upon.

The scope of the playing arena should be determined, and the boundaries marked with neon tape so that players will know where and/or where not to go.

What are the factors to consider when scouting for a field to hold the games?

First, there is the price. The going rates for field rentals range from $15-20, plus the fees for gun rentals and paintballs. Secondly, one should inquire if the place serves food and drinks to customers. Lastly, one should inquire about their playing hours.

Among the important paintball accessories that a player should possess, aside from the paintball guns and pellets of course, are the following:

1. Paintball mask - Never play paintball without the mask! Paintball experts are as one in saying that new players should buy the mask before the gun because it is a safety tool.

2. Batteries - Spare batteries for your guns will always be handy in case your gun needs them. Why waste a good opportunity to fire upon your enemy just because of a battery failure.

3. Oil for the paintball gun - This tool may not top the list of items being carried by paintball players but believe me; it makes your gun more efficient and keeps it in tip-top shape.

4. Gun manual - This is necessary when you have to take your gun apart and then put it back together again. With a gun manual, you can never go wrong.

5. First aid kits - While paintball is not a particularly dangerous sport, carrying a first aid kit in one's pockets will not hurt - in fact, it is necessary for the unexpected bumps and bruises that occur while playing the game.
